Is targeted cytomegalovirus testing of infants feasible in Western Australia? An observational study

A Western Australian study found a targeted congenital cytomegalovirus (cCMV) testing program is feasible. Implementing this program ensures high-risk infants receive timely diagnosis and intervention for cCMV, preventing potential hearing loss.

Background:

  • Congenital cytomegalovirus (cCMV) is a leading cause of non-genetic hearing loss in infants.
  • Current Australian guidelines recommend targeted cCMV testing for high-risk infants, but a formal program is lacking.
  • Early diagnosis and intervention are crucial for managing cCMV-related morbidities.

Purpose of the Study:

  • To evaluate the feasibility of a targeted cCMV testing program in Western Australia (WA).
  • To assess the effectiveness of using the universal infant hearing-screening program to identify infants at high risk for cCMV.
  • To analyze the timeliness of testing, results, and follow-up care for infants identified as high-risk.

Main Methods:

  • A 2-year statewide observational study (2020-2022) in WA.
  • Recruitment of infants who failed newborn hearing screening for saliva PCR testing.
  • Exploration of barriers to testing eligibility and assessment of timely reviews for cCMV-positive infants.

Main Results:

  • 212 high-risk infants identified; 134 (63%) met inclusion criteria, and 103 (77%) consented.
  • Achieved complete and timely cCMV testing and follow-up for positive cases.
  • Identified barriers to testing eligibility in 78 high-risk infants.

Conclusions:

  • Western Australia lacks a structured targeted cCMV testing program, leading to missed opportunities.
  • A structured, targeted cCMV testing program is feasible in WA.
  • Implementation would align care with national/international standards and improve outcomes for affected children.
